Do you have any tips for my flight to Penalva Do Castelo?
Wherever you're coming from, flying can be a seamless experience if you've planned ahead. Check out these handy travel tips that will get your Penalva Do Castelo holiday started on the right foot. What to pack in your hand luggage:

  • The trick to having a stress-free travel experience is to be prepared. First up, the essentials: passport, official ID, credit cards and vital medications. Next, bring items that'll help keep you entertained, like your laptop or a magazine. You'll also want to pack your chargers, a neck pillow and a pair of noise-cancelling headphones. Last but not least, don't forget to toss in toiletry items like a toothbrush, deodorant and a clean set of clothes.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• While the list of banned items differs between airlines, the general guide to follow is avoid carrying anything flammable, sharp or explosive. This includes screwdrivers, blades, spray paint and flares. Sporting equipment like golf clubs, and objects that could harm passengers, such as swords and batons, are also banned from the cabin.

What to wear on a flight:

  • Choose comfort over style. Prepare for changes in cabin temperature by donning layers, and opt for flat, closed-toe shoes like slip-ons.
  • The result of lengthy periods of inactivity, deep vein thrombosis (DVT) is a blood clotting condition that can affect passengers during long-distance flights. Reduce the risks by drinking water, keeping your feet and legs moving and wearing compression socks or tights.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Penalva Do Castelo?
As seasoned travellers know, the secret is to be well prepared before you arrive at airport security. That way, you'll be hopping onto that plane to Penalva Do Castelo before you know it. Follow these helpful tips and get your holiday off to a spectacular start:

  • First things first. Your boarding pass and passport will need to be presented to security personnel. Keep them handy so you don't hold up the line.
  • Time to strip down. Well sort of. Your jacket, belt, keys and other items in your pocket, like your headphones, will be required to go through the X-ray machine. Make the whole process easier by removing them before your turn.
  • Electronic devices like laptops and phones will also need to go on a tray to be scanned. Don't worry, you'll be back online soon enough.
  • Travelling with a new hand and nail cream? As long as the volume is no greater than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res) and it's stored in a zip-lock bag, you can keep it with you in your carry-on bag.
  • Choosing your footwear wisely can save you several precious minutes. Hiking boots are often required to be removed and separately scanned. Slip-on shoes are usually not.
  • Sharp or pointed items are prohibited in the cabin. They'll be seized at security, so pack them in your checked baggage.
